Lottery online is a service provided by websites that offer players a chance to play a lottery game for real money. This type of gambling is legal in many jurisdictions, though the exact laws vary by country and region. Some countries prohibit it altogether, while others regulate it and tax winners accordingly. While most lottery games are based on chance, some use skill as part of their game play, which increases the chances of winning a prize. Many of these games are offered through a website, and the prizes can be anything from cash to electronics or vehicles.

The lottery was originally a form of public entertainment in the Middle Ages and later became a popular way to raise money for government projects. Today it is a major source of revenue for governments worldwide. In addition, the lottery is used to fund religious and charitable organizations. In the United States, the lottery is a national game with more than 15 million active players. The top prize is usually several million dollars, and the jackpot can reach hundreds of millions.

New Zealand has four nationwide lottery games: Lotto, Lotto Super 7, Instant Kiwi, and Keno. The New Zealand Lottery Commission is an autonomous Crown entity that operates the games and distributes the profits to the community. The majority of profits are distributed through the Lottery Grants Board to sport, recreation, arts, and cultural agencies. In addition, a smaller percentage is shared amongst a number of government agencies including the Ministry of Education, Health, Housing, and Environment.

Canada has a national lottery, called the Interprovincial Lottery Corporation. The corporation is composed of five regional lottery corporations owned by their respective provincial and territorial governments: Atlantic Lottery Corporation (New Brunswick, Nova Scotia, Prince Edward Island, and Newfoundland), Loto-Quebec (Quebec), Ontario Lottery and Gaming Corporation (Ontario), Western Canada Lottery Corporation (Manitoba, Saskatchewan, Alberta, Yukon, Northwest Territories, and Nunavut), and BC Lottery Corporation (British Columbia). In addition to these national lotteries, there are also numerous private lotteries that operate in Canada.

There have been concerns about the integrity of the state lottery in Laos, a concern that was raised by the appearance of the same numbers four times in a row last month. The number, representing the cat, or Felis catus, in the culture of the country, came up as the winner of the lottery three out of four times. Vilasack Phommaluck, deputy finance minister and state lottery supervisor, defended the lottery system, telling RFA that the lottery committee double checks the balls.
